(5 posts)Here's part of a post on the debate from a blog today: (pragmaticliberalism.com)
"Trump looked most unpresidential. He was bombastic, insulting to Mexico and most Mexican-Americans, and women in particular. His changed positions made him, despite his lame protestations otherwise, look more like the pandering politicians he vilifies so often. He is thin-skinned and clearly let his angry self show up, front and center. His nasty response to Fox moderator Megyn Kelly will only exacerbate his mainstream image as a nasty man, if not personally repugnant to many Americans, not likely to be one that would have a chance in a general election. I also dont think it will be very long before the lie he put forth that no one would be talking about illegal immigration if he hadnt, will tear at the fabric of his believability. It has been one of the most discussed, and divisive, subjects in the partisan political divide for some time. Additionally, very old-line politician-like, he gave vague and uninformative answers throughout the evening. When asked by Kelly about his misogynist past Donaldisms describing women, he was down on as fat pigs, dogs, slobs and disgusting animals, Trump replied, in a wholly unsatisfactory manner, Only Rosie ODonnell. A poor attempt at humor, that only reinforced the misogyny charge. The image was hardly what most Americans want from an American president. "
